.blog-placeholder{margin:0 1.5rem;background:rgb(var(--color-background))}.blog__posts.articles-wrapper .article.blog-list-style .article-card-wrapper .card.article-card{width:100%;align-self:self-start;overflow:hidden;display:flex;flex-direction:row;gap:var(--grid-desktop-horizontal-spacing)}.blog__posts.articles-wrapper .article.blog-overlay-style .card__inner{position:absolute;left:0;top:0;height:100%;overflow:hidden;z-index:0}.blog__posts.articles-wrapper .article.blog-overlay-style{scroll-snap-align:start;position:relative;margin-left:0}.blog__posts.articles-wrapper .blog__post .card--standard>.card__content .card__information{padding:20px}.featured-blog .slider:not(.slider--everywhere):not(.slider--desktop)+.slider-buttons{display:flex;align-items:center;justify-content:center}.featured-blog .slider--tablet:after{content:"";width:0;padding-left:1.5rem;margin-left:calc(-1 * var(--grid-desktop-horizontal-spacing))}.featured-blog .slider.slider--tablet.contains-card--standard .slider__slide:not(.collection-list__item--no-media){padding:var(--focus-outline-padding)}.featured-blog .slider.slider--tablet{position:relative;flex-wrap:inherit;overflow-x:auto;scroll-snap-type:x mandatory;scroll-behavior:smooth;scroll-padding-left:auto}.blog .page-width{margin:0 auto}.featured-blog .slider:not(.slider--everywhere):not(.slider--desktop)+.slider-buttons{display:flex;margin-top:20px}.featured-blog .slider-buttons .slider-button{width:30px;height:30px;background:var(--gradient-base-background-1);box-shadow:0 0 20px #00000026}.featured-blog .slider-buttons .slider-button:hover{color:var(--gradient-base-background-1);background:var(--gradient-base-accent-1)}.blog__posts .blog__post.blog-overlay-style .card:not(.ratio)>.card__content{z-index:1;grid-template-rows:max-content minmax(0,1fr) max-content auto}.blog-placeholder__content{padding:3rem;background:rgba(var(--color-foreground),.04)}.blog-placeholder .placeholder{position:relative}.blog-placeholder h2{margin:0}.blog-placeholder .rte-width{margin-top:1.2rem;color:rgba(var(--color-foreground),.75)}.blog__title{margin:0}.blog__posts.articles-wrapper{margin-bottom:1rem}.blog__posts.articles-wrapper .article{scroll-snap-align:start}.background-secondary .blog-placeholder__content{background-color:rgb(var(--color-background))}.blog.featured-blg .blog-list-style .card.article-card{color:var(--gradient-base-background-1)}.blog.featured-blg .blog-posts,.blog.featured-blg .right-image{width:100%;max-width:50%;padding:1rem 0}.blog.featured-blg .blog__posts.articles-wrapper>.article .card__content{padding:2.5rem 0;position:relative;border:none;background:var(--gradient-base-background-3);border-radius:0}.blog.featured-blg .blog__posts.articles-wrapper>.article:first-child .card__content{padding-top:0}.blog.featured-blg .blog__posts.articles-wrapper>.article .card__content:after{content:"";position:absolute;width:100%;height:6px;margin:auto;bottom:0;right:0;opacity:1;-webkit-mask-repeat:repeat-x;-webkit-mask-size:auto;background-color:var(--gradient-base-background-1);-webkit-mask-image:url("data:image/svg+xml,%3Csvg version='1.1' xmlns='http://www.w3.org/2000/svg' xmlns:xlink='http://www.w3.org/1999/xlink' x='0px' y='0px' viewBox='0 0 19.2 4.3' style='enable-background:new 0 0 19.2 4.3;' xml:space='preserve'%3E%3Cpath d='M19.2,1.8c-0.4,0-1.6,0.8-2.3,1.3c-1.2,0.8-1.9,1.2-2.5,1.2S13,3.9,11.8,3C11.1,2.5,10,1.8,9.6,1.8C9.2,1.8,8.1,2.5,7.4,3 C6.2,3.8,5.5,4.3,4.8,4.3C4,4.3,3.2,3.7,2.3,3C1.5,2.5,0.6,1.8,0,1.8c0,0.1,0-1.6,0-1.5c1,0,2.1,0.8,3.1,1.5c0.5,0.4,1.4,1,1.7,1 s1.2-0.6,1.7-1c1.1-0.8,2.2-1.5,3-1.5c0.7,0,1.6,0.6,3,1.5c0.6,0.4,1.5,1,1.8,1c0.2,0,1-0.6,1.6-1c1.3-0.8,2.4-1.5,3.3-1.5'/%3E%3Cline class='under-dec' x1='0' y1='0' x2='0' y2='0'/%3E%3C/svg%3E")}.blog.featured-blg .blog__posts.articles-wrapper>.article:last-child .card__content:after{display:none}.blog.featured-blg .blog__posts.articles-wrapper{gap:0;margin-bottom:20px}.blog.featured-blg .title-wrapper-with-link.content-align--left{margin-bottom:20px}.blog.featured-blg .blog__posts .card__information .article-card__info{margin-bottom:0;text-align:center;display:inline-block}.blog.featured-blg :where(.card__content) :where(.inline-blog){margin-bottom:6px;gap:15px}.blog.featured-blg :where(.title-wrapper-with-link,.slider-mobile-gutter,.blog__view-all){width:82%;padding-right:10%;margin-right:0;margin-left:auto}.blog.featured-blg :where(.blog__view-all){text-align:left}.blog.featured-blg .blog-posts{position:relative}.blog.featured-blg .blog-posts .blog-left-side-image{width:100%;position:absolute;max-width:18%;height:100%;display:flex;align-content:space-between;flex-wrap:wrap;top:0;left:0}.blog.featured-blg :where(.blog-left-img){position:relative;width:100%}.blog.featured-blg :where(.blog-left-img.bot-image)>img{width:auto;max-width:10rem;transform:translate(-30%,-100%);object-fit:contain;height:10rem}.blog.featured-blg :where(.blog-left-img.top-image)>img{width:auto;max-width:20rem;transform:translate(-30%,-40%)}.blog.featured-blg :where(.circle-divider):after{display:none}.blog.featured-blg :where(span.circle-divider){font-size:16px;font-weight:400;width:6rem;display:block;letter-spacing:normal;margin-right:0;color:var(--gradient-base-background-1)}.blog.featured-blg :where(.card__content) :where(.article-card__info)>.fa-calendar{font-size:18px;line-height:1.64;width:100%;color:var(--gradient-base-accent-3)}.blog.featured-blg :where(.card__content)>.card__information{padding:0}.blog.featured-blg .right-image{display:flex;align-content:space-between;flex-wrap:wrap;justify-content:space-between}.blog.featured-blg :where(.blog__view-all) .blog__button{margin-top:0rem}.blog.featured-blg .blog-list-style .card.article-card{border:none}.blog.featured-blg :where(.article-card__excerpt){display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}@media screen and (min-width: 1921px){.blog:before,.blog:after{-webkit-mask-size:100% 100%}}@media screen and (max-width: 1639px){.blog:before,.blog:after{-webkit-mask-image:none!important}.blog .row{flex-direction:column;row-gap:6rem!important}.blog.featured-blg .blog-posts,.blog.featured-blg .right-image{width:100%;max-width:112rem;margin:auto}.blog .blog-center-image{top:-3%}.blog.featured-blg .right-image .right-image_svg{display:none!important}.blog.featured-blg .right-image{align-items:center}.blog.featured-blg .right-image .right-img.bot{margin:0!important}.blog .blog-center-image{display:none!important}.blog.featured-blg :where(.blog-left-img.bot-image)>img{transform:translate(10%,-100%)}.blog.featured-blg :where(.blog-left-img.top-image)>img{transform:translateY(-40%)}}@media screen and (max-width: 1279px){.blog.featured-blg .blog-posts .blog-left-side-image{display:none}.blog.featured-blg :where(.title-wrapper-with-link,.slider-mobile-gutter,.blog__view-all){width:80%;min-width:26rem;padding-left:0;padding-right:0;margin-right:auto;margin-left:auto}}@media screen and (min-width: 750px){.blog-placeholder{text-align:center;width:50%;margin:0}}@media screen and (min-width: 990px){.grid--1-col-desktop .article-card .card__content{text-align:center}.blog__posts.articles-wrapper{margin-bottom:0}}@media screen and (max-width: 989px){.featured-blog .slider:not(.slider--everywhere):not(.slider--mobile)+.slider-buttons{display:none}.blog.featured-blg .right-image{align-items:center;row-gap:6rem;margin:auto;justify-content:center;flex-direction:column;align-content:center;max-width:45rem}.blog.featured-blg .blog__posts.articles-wrapper .article{width:100%;max-width:100%}.blog.featured-blg .blog__posts.articles-wrapper{flex-direction:column}.blog.featured-blg .title-wrapper-with-link.content-align--left{padding-left:0}}@media screen and (max-width: 749px){.page-width-desktop .grid--peek.slider .grid__item:first-of-type{margin-left:auto}.blog__posts.articles-wrapper .article.blog-list-style .article-card-wrapper .card.article-card{flex-direction:column;gap:var(--grid-desktop-horizontal-spacing)}.blog.featured-blg .title-wrapper-with-link.content-align--left{align-items:center;text-align:center}}@media screen and (max-width: 576px){.page-width-desktop .grid--peek .grid__item{min-width:100%}}@supports not (inset: 10px){@media screen and (min-width: 750px){.blog__posts .article+.article{margin-left:var(--grid-desktop-horizontal-spacing)}}}@media screen and (min-width: 400px){.blog-list-style .card.article-card{display:flex;flex-direction:row}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/section-featured-blog.css.map */
